mapper.xml网!

mapper.xml网

趋势迷

apper.x

2024-08-14 02:33:57 来源:网络

apper.x

请教新版本IDEA2023.1.1在mapper.xml中Ctrl+Q为什么不显示表字段注释了...
在IntelliJ IDEA 2023.1.1版本中,应该仍然支持在mapper.xml文件中使用Ctrl+Q查看表字段注释。这个问题可能是由于某些设置或插件引起的。以下是一些建议,可以尝试解决这个问题:1. 确保MyBatis插件已经安装并启用。可以在IDEA的设置中查看插件列表,如果没有安装,请安装并重新启动IDEA。2. 检查项目的JDBC有帮助请点赞。
(1)在yml里面配置mapper文件的路径mybatis:     type-aliases-package: com.entity      mapper-locations: classpath:mapper/*.xml (2)在启动类里面添加mapper类的扫描包SpringBootApplication MapperScan("com.mapper")public class PlanApplication {} (1说完了。

apper.x

java报错:不存在路径 -
1.mapper.xml 里面的namespace与实际类不一样 mapper.xml 里面的namespace应该是其对应的接口路径。这个有个快捷的检测办法就是按住ctrl键,然后点击namespace里面的包名,如果能跳到对应的类,那就说明没问题。2.mapper接口的函数名称和mapper.xml里面的标签id不一致 这个问题也很常见,最好的后面会介绍。
没有办法通用,一般一个表对应一个自动生成的mapper.xml和一个自定义的mapper.xml。现在都是直接用mybatis的插件自动生成的mapper文件,里面已经具备基本的增删改查方法,可以直接使用。如果不能满足自己的需求,可在此基础上进行内容扩展。
一个mybatis的mapper.xml文件,如何被其他的mapper.xml引用? -
例如你选择在mapper1.xml:lt;mapper namespace="com.foo.bar.mapper.Mapper1">select * form entity1 </mapper> 它可以mapper2.xml使用:lt;mapper namespace="com.foo.bar.mapper.Mapper2"><resultMap id="entity2ResultMap" type="Entity2"><association property="entity1"column="entity1_id"java到此结束了?。
自定义对象也用@param注解.在mapper.xml中使用的时候,{对象别名.属性名},如#{user.id}注意,使用了@pram注解的话在mapper.xml不加parameterType。publicListselectAllUsers(@Param("user")UserExtensionuser,@Param("begin")
MyBatis的Mapper.xml怎么同时执行多个sql语句 -
hikariConfig.security.jdbcUrl=jdbc:mysql://xx.xx.xx:3306/xxxxx?characterEncoding=utf-8&autoReconnect=true&failOverReadOnly=false&allowMultiQueries=true 2、直接写多条语句,用“;”隔开即可<delete id="deleteUserById" parameterType="String"> delete from sec_user_role where userId=#{说完了。
Mapper接口需要遵循一些开发规范,mybatis可以自动生成mapper接口实现类代理对象。开发规范:1.在mapper.xml中namespace等于mapper.Java接口地址(<mapper namespace="com.zucc.dao.UserMapper">)2.Mapper.java接口中的方法名和mapper.xml中statement的id一致(select id="addUser")3.Mapper.java接口中的方法希望你能满意。
MyBatis的Mapper.xml怎么同时执行多个sql语句 -
是指一个还有呢?中的多个吗?这样的话直接调用这个方法就可以,要是你指的是和<insert></insert>貌似mybatis不能这样使用,因为他一般是一个方法对应一个sql语句,你想是想一个方法调用两个sql语句,要么就是在一个方法里调用那两个方法,这样间接实现一个方法调用两个sql语句(本质上还是一个方法一还有呢?
是的如果你的对象字段和数据库字段不对应你的xml文件上面应该有对象和数据库字段映射的配置resultMap